Active Release Technique

Active Release Technique: ART is a skilled soft tissue technique that combines massage and movement to treat problems with muscles, fascia, ligaments, tendons, and nerves. ART has been successful in treating tendonitis syndromes like tennis elbow or rotator cuff strains, as well as low back pain, headaches, carpal tunnel syndrome, plantar fasciitis, and knee problems to name a few.

This technique was developed and patented by Dr. Leahy, DC, CCSP who recognized the microscopic and macroscopic properties of muscles and how those properties responded to injury. Dr. Leahy developed ART to combine certain types of pressing, manipulating, and stripping to release adhesions and improve soft tissue function. The ART provider uses his or her hands to evaluate the texture, tightness, and movement of muscles, fascia, tendons, ligaments, and nerves. Abnormal tissues are treated by combining precisely directed tension with very specific patient movements.
